🎾 ATP Barcelona: Etcheverry vs De Minaur – Match Preview
🧠 Form & Context
🇦🇺 Alex de Minaur
- 2024 Clay Record: 10–4
- Monte Carlo Form: SF finish, including 6–0, 6–0 win over Dimitrov
- Barcelona Record: 4–0 in opening rounds, SF in 2022
- Strengths: Elite speed, point construction, improving clay skillset
🇦🇷 Tomas Martin Etcheverry
- 2024 Clay Record: 5–5
- Barcelona History: SF in 2023; defending big points
- Recent Struggles: Losses to Diallo, Kovacevic, and Fokina
- Game Style: Heavy topspin, traditional clay movement, long rallies
🔍 Match Breakdown
De Minaur is enjoying his best stretch on clay, highlighted by his dazzling Monte Carlo run. His enhanced ability to extend rallies, flatten balls on the rise, and apply pressure with movement is proving tough for clay specialists to counter.
Etcheverry’s slump in form is poorly timed—especially as he defends semifinal points from 2023. Unless he rediscovers rhythm quickly, he may not withstand the physical and mental pressure De Minaur will apply from the baseline.
